In 2026, the smartphone market has shifted from raw hardware specs to 'Personalized AI Experiences.' In this landscape, the release of the **iPhone 17e**, Apple's new budget strategy model, is making quite a splash. Traditionally, Apple's 'e' or 'SE' lineups offered the latest processor but with clear 'tier-cutting' in display or convenience features. The iPhone 17e, however, breaks this mold. By introducing **MagSafe** and raising the base storage to **256GB** to accommodate high-res video and AI data, Apple has transformed its budget iPhone from a 'cheap model' into a 'practical masterpiece.'

10-Year Pro Editor's Analysis

Having watched the evolution of the iPhone for a decade, I can say with confidence that the addition of MagSafe to the 17e is more than just a magnet—it's an invitation. For the first time, budget-conscious users can seamlessly enter Apple's vast accessory ecosystem without relying on third-party cases. Whether it's the MagSafe wallet, car mounts, or magnetic battery packs, the user experience is now truly 'Seamless.' Furthermore, starting with 256GB is a strategic move for the AI era. Apple Intelligence requires significant on-device storage for processing and learning. While 128GB was once sufficient, it fills up quickly in the age of high-res photos and AI caches. This makes the iPhone 17e perhaps the best iPhone to hold onto for the next 3 to 5 years.

1. A19 Chip: AI Performance Beyond the Budget

The **A19 chip** in the iPhone 17e is optimized for on-device AI. Tasks like the AI background remover in photos or real-time voice memo summarization feel as snappy as they do on the Pro models. Power efficiency has also been improved, allowing the 17e to punch above its weight in daily battery life through smart software optimization.

2. MagSafe and 6.1-inch OLED

While it lacks 120Hz ProMotion, the 6.1-inch OLED panel is stunning. With a 20% brightness boost over the previous generation, outdoor visibility is excellent. The inclusion of MagSafe changes charging habits entirely—no more fumbling with cables at night.

3. Verdict: Buy it or Skip it?

Buy it!

  • **Value Seekers**: Pro-level chip and essential features without the Pro price.
  • **Storage Needers**: 256GB base storage for your long-term photos and AI apps.
  • **MagSafe Fans**: Access to Apple's best magnetic accessory ecosystem.

Skip it!

  • **Refresh Rate Snobs**: If you need 120Hz ProMotion, this isn't for you.
  • **Zoom Lovers**: Lacks a dedicated telephoto lens for long-distance shots.
  • **Big Screen Fans**: If you want a 6.7" display, you'll need the Plus or Max.

FAQ

What is the battery life of the iPhone 17e?

Thanks to the efficient A19 chip, it lasts a full day for most users. Expect around 18-20 hours of video playback.

Does it support the same MagSafe speed as Pro models?

Yes, it supports the latest MagSafe standard for 15W wireless charging.
